The Nurburgring: Tucked away in the Eiffel Mountains in Western Germany is a racing circuit that is longer, more dramatic and more difficult to master than any other racing circuit in the world. Not known for a particular race, unlike Le Mans, Indianapolis or Monaco, the Nurburgring is famous simply because it is the most challenging circuit ever built! Silverstone: Silverstone is not set in majestic parklands or near an exotic beach; it is a windy former airfield in the midlands of England. Yet, it is the very heartland of motor racing and is the central point for most of the teams in Grand Prix Racing. Silverstone has always been renowned for its high speeds and is regarded by many as THE track to do well at. Indeed, if you win at Silverstone the world sits up and takes notice. Monaco: The Monaco Grand Prix is the most famous race of them all and always provides the driver a tough race around the extremely tight circuit. Now the only round the houses circuit left on the Formula One calendar, Racing Through Time: Great Circuits charts all the action from the tracks illustrious past: From its origins way back in 1929 to the glitz and glamour it is famed for today.

Insightful; up to a point.
I've found this DVD a useful and resourceful product within a very limited historical context. The facts are insightful but lacking in depth into what made these circuits as revered as they are today besides a few classic races any new fan after 1980 can relate to today. If you're not a but simply interested in learning something new, all you'll get is a lot of historical facts about Nazi race drivers and classic race cars that have little to do with modern day F1. The DVD has very few moments designed to engage a novice into the world of motor sports. If you're an enthusiast, which I believe is the target audience of this DVD, you'll be still left wanting more facts about the circuits and less narratives about post war race drivers.
